Lately the Los Angeles Philharmonic has been making the move from hip replacement to placement in hipster vocabularies. Last year it was Belle & Sebastian teaming up with the orchestra, July sees them joining forces with the Decemberists, and now it's been announced that weepy troubadour Conner Oberst will get the chance to perform with an impeccably tailored backing band when Bright Eyes takes the stage at the Hollywood Bowl on September 29th. Bright Eye's Nate Walcott will be providing the arrangements for the show, tickets for which go on sale Saturday, June 9th.

Currently, the band is playing the European festival circuit, so if you just can't wait, we suggest flying on a weekday, when it's cheaper.
